For those that don't know the issues here it is. The car vibrates quite a bit around 35-45 mph (coasting in neutral or in gear). The vibration can be felt in the shifter as well as the steering wheel.

Cliffnotes version. Basically there are two different vibrations (at least I'm calling them different):

1.) Coasting around 35-50 mph
2.) Every gear at 1900 - 2100 RPM

But the vibration isn't really there when sitting still and reving in neutral. At least its not as strong if its there at all...

I realize that this could indeed be two separate issues but I'm trying to tackle the rolling vibration first. Here's what I've done so far to try and eliminate it.

-New crush sleeve and pinion nut
-Balanced drive shaft
-Checked input shaft end play (got .000", could it be too tight, and would this cause a vibration?)

I'm going to have the wheels balanced first to see if that could be the problem and then I'm going to look into the input shaft bearing race possibly being shimmed too far since I had NO endplay. Can to tight of a clearance on the input shaft cause a vibration?

You're worried about it too much if you haven't recently balanced your tires.

It obviously has to be a rotating part, and the fact that it doesn't do it when you rev in neutral factors out any engine imbalance. Next, if you haven't already, try reving with the clutch pedal out and the car in neutral and that will ensure you're not having any clutch or input shaft imbalances. FWIW, I've never heard of a transmission being the problem of a vibration without it being obvious, though I'm not discounting the possibility.

If you have no vibrations to this point, then the vibration problem has to lie in the following possibilities: the rear end of the transmission (a .01% likelihood), the driveshaft (a ~20% probability), the rear end internals (.01%), tire balance (75%), rear-end offset (5%). What I mean by rear end offset includes everything from pinion angle if the car's ride height has been changed to any damage that may have caused the axle housings to come out of alignment.

Borrow a set of wheels and try it. Make sure your pinion angle is correct. Too small an angle will produce vibration even though the driveshaft is balanced. Try duplicating it on a frame type lift if nothing else works.

I clearly have two different vibrations and I've made some headway with the standing still one at 2000. I'm begining to think that the standing still one isn't something to worry about but I'm still going to look into it.

Here is what I've done to try and pinpoint the standing still one thus far:
-Last night, I tried taking the drive belt off to see if the vibration was still there and it was, which proves that all accessories are fine.
-Checked the balancer and its fine
-Put the trans in gear with the clutch in and gave it 2000 rpm. The vibration was still there which now limits the vibration to:
-------Flywheel balance
-------Clutch / Pressure Plate Balance (defective from factory)
-------Pilot bearing was defective (may not be properly spinning on the input shaft)

So to solve the standing still vibration, I'm going to drop the trans, put in a new pilot bearing being careful not to damage it and find a shop that balances clutches and flywheels. When you have the tranny out, reinstall the bellhousing and measure the depth from the tranny mounting surface to the center of the crankshaft (inside the pilot bearing hole). Then measure the tranny from the mounting surface to the end of the input shaft. My thought is the input shaft may be bottoming out in the hole and that's why you had to 'pull' the tranny in. You may be able to see it on the tip of the shaft also. This might have caused damage to the needle bearings inside your tranny and cause your vibration.
